MATLAB使用方法和程序设计,实验一 Matlab使用方法和基本程序设计

实验详细介绍了Matlab的使用,包括帮助命令的使用、矩阵运算(乘法、除法、转置)、基本程序设计(for、while循环结构)以及绘图命令的应用。学生需掌握矩阵操作、程序调试及图形绘制,通过实验提升Matlab技能。
摘要由CSDN通过智能技术生成

实验一 Matlab使用方法和基本程序设计

一、实验要求

1、掌握Matlab软件使用的基本方法;

2、掌握Matlab的基本操作;

3、熟悉Matlab的数据表示、基本运算和程序控制语句;

4、熟悉Matlab程序设计的基本方法及调试;

5、熟悉Matlab绘图命令及基本绘图控制。

二、实验内容:

1、帮助命令

使用help命令,查找 sqrt(开方)函数的使用方法;

2、矩阵运算

(1)矩阵的乘法

已知A=[1 2;3 4]; B=[5 5;7 8];

求A^2*B

(2)矩阵除法

已知 A=[1 2 3;4 5 6;7 8 9]; B=[1 0 0;0 2 0;0 0 3];

求A\B,A/B

(3)矩阵的转置及共轭转置

已知A=[5+i,2-i,1;6*i,4,9-i];

求A.', A'

(4)使用冒号选出指定元素

已知: A=[1 2 3;4 5 6;7 8 9];

求A中第3列所有元素;A中所有列第2,3行的元素;

3、基本程序设计

(1)分别用for和while循环结构编写程序:计算1+2+??+100的值;

(2)编写(1)所对应的m函数文件。

4、基本绘图命令

(1)在同一坐标系中绘制余弦曲线y=cos(t),y=cos(t-0.25)和正弦曲线y=sin(t-0.5), t∈[0,2π]

(2)绘制[0,4π]区间上的x1=10sint曲线,并要求:

1)线形为点划线、颜色为红色、数据点标记为加号;

2)坐标轴控制:显示范围、网络线;

3)标注控制:坐标轴名称、标题;

三、实验报告内容要求

1.程序调试的情况,出了什么问题,如何解决的?

2.程序运行的情况记录。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值